Cultural variations over space arise from the diverse historical, geographical, and social contexts of different regions. Factors such as climate, resources, migration patterns, and local traditions shape how communities develop their beliefs, practices, and lifestyles. Additionally, interactions between cultures through trade, conquest, and globalization can lead to both the exchange of ideas and the preservation of distinct cultural identities. As a result, cultural expressions, norms, and values can differ significantly even among neighboring areas.
No, you cannot survive in space without a spacesuit. Space is a vacuum, meaning there is no atmosphere to provide oxygen or protect you from extreme temperature variations and radiation. A spacesuit is essential for providing life support systems to allow humans to survive in the harsh conditions of space.

Variations can appear to disappear due to a phenomenon called regression to the mean. This occurs when extreme values in a data set are more likely to be followed by values closer to the average. Additionally, random fluctuations in data can sometimes give the appearance of variations disappearing when in reality they are just temporary fluctuations.
An example of cultural geography would be studying how traditional clothing styles vary across different regions and why these variations exist. This would involve examining the social, historical, and environmental factors that influence people's dress choices and understanding how clothing is reflective of cultural identity.
If you threw water into space, intermolecular forces would cause the water to form globules or droplets. Heat would radiate out of these little blobs very quickly, and the water would freeze solid in seconds.

The atomists would explain the differences between drops as variations in the configuration and movement of atoms. They would argue that differences in size, shape, and chemical composition of drops are a result of the atoms they are made of and how these atoms are arranged and interact with each other. Additionally, they might suggest that external factors such as temperature and pressure play a role in shaping these differences.
